Nouveaux badges et couleurs icones (card_mod)

C’est ce que je fais :wink:
image

Crotte !
Je n’ai pas testé depuis la dernière MàJ HA.

ÉDIT : ça marche pas :tired_face::tired_face::tired_face:

1 « J'aime »

Je vais ouvrir une issue sur custom-ui, alors :slight_smile:

Ok ça marche ! Envoie le lien de l’issue que je like afin d’appuyer la demande si tu veux.

1 « J'aime »

J’ai trouvé une solution, en passant par un thème.

Avec :

  #door
  state-binary_sensor-door-off-color: green
  state-binary_sensor-door-on-color: red
  #motion
  state-binary_sensor-motion-off-color: green
  state-binary_sensor-motion-on-color: red

image
image

2 « J'aime »

Ne règle pas le pb si je veux un template aux petits oignons comme une couleur basée sur une autre entité… Ou un sensor template quelconque, comme un custom compteur.

1 « J'aime »

Oui, mais pour deux états, ca fais le job :slight_smile:
le dev de custom-ui, ne feras rien pour corriger ça.

1 « J'aime »

Ca n’a pas fonctionné meme apres refresh du theme, pour la couleur dans les badges du header. (mouvements et portes)

Fais un CTRL + R dans ton navigateur.

image
image

met bien l’option color: state

  - type: entity
    show_state: true
    show_icon: true
    entity: binary_sensor.0x00158d0008068ad1_contact
    color: state
  - type: entity
    show_state: true
    show_icon: true
    entity: binary_sensor.0x00158d0008074924_contact
    color: state

regarde que t’es bien le device_class pour t’es binary_sensor , door et motion.

1 « J'aime »

J’ai tout ca bien sur.
Et les device class sont forcement bon puisque sensors créés en UI …

Salut, je me permet de rebondir sur le sujet.
Il est possible que les couleurs changent en fonction d’une valeur numérique ? (pour la température par exemple).
Avec le code :

type: entity
show_name: false
show_state: true
show_icon: true
entity: sensor.magic_areas_aggregates_salon_aggregate_temperature
color: state

image
Ou avec ce genre de condition:

        icon_color: |
          {% if is_state(entity, 'on') %}
            orange
          {% else %}  
            white
          {% endif %}

Merci.

Bonjour,
tu ne peux pas changer la couleur en fonction d’une valeur numérique. C’est très limité en modification des couleurs de ces badges.

tu ne peux changer la couleur que suivant un état on/off par un thème :

1 « J'aime »

Salut,

Je ne suis pas certain mais regarde ce sujet :

Je pense que ça ressemble à ce que tu veux faire (j’avais le même problème) :wink:

++

Sauf que lui parle des badges dans un heading des sections. Pas des badges en haut de page.

1 « J'aime »

Ah ok, désolé, mal lu/compris :sweat_smile:

1 « J'aime »